Have Irregular Periods, Swollen Tummy And Frequent Urination. Cause?

Hi, i am 32, i have had regular periods since the age of 14 but they have become very irregular and i have recently missed one and my latest lasted only a day. i sometimes suffer from a swollen tummy making me look around 5 months pregnant, it is painful and obviously uncomfortable and rather embarassing. i at times am also needed to unrinate nore frequently, i recently took my children on a day trip and on the 1h 45m trip there i had to stop at service stations 3 times, i had only had 1 cup of tea that morining and unrinated before leaving home.

The first thing you need to do is that you have to consult a gynecologist and you need to be investigated.At your age some may develop pre menopause symptoms which rare for your age but some will get the symptoms too early.Coming to the swollen tummy you need to have a scan so that we can figure it out.In some people H.mole develops in which they have symptoms like pregnancy but you can rule out by doing a scan .Hcg levels may also be increased and due to that it may compress your bladder and you have symptoms like frequent urination.And you need to checck your sugar levels too due to the symptom of frequent urination.But among all usg scan is necessary.Thank you.If you still have more doubts you can contact me here at any time.

May be due to P C O S ( Poly Cystic Ovarian Disorder ) .
Scanty menstruation, obese, tummy enlarged, frequent urination all are an indication of ovarian cyst.
2nd reason may be due to URINARY INFECTION.
may be due to diabetes.
Consult a gynaecologist / physician and get ultrasound abdomen and blood examination .
